Problem Statement

Let ana_n be the number of unordered sets of three distinct bijections f,g,h:{1,2,...,n}{1,2,...,n}f, g, h : \{1, 2, ..., n\} \to \{1, 2, ..., n\} such that the composition of any two of the bijections equals the third. What is the largest value in the sequence a1,a2,...a_1, a_2, ... which is less than 20212021?
